B. Assemble Slip Sections

• Slide the inner fl ue of the slip section into the inner fl ue of

the pipe section and the outer fl ue of the slip section over
the outer fl ue of the pipe section. See Figure 10.6.

• Slide together to the desired length.

• Continue adding pipe as necessary following instructions

in “Assembling Pipe Sections.”

NOTICE: If slip section is too long, the inner and outer fl ues
of the slip section can be cut to the desired length.

• Maintain a 1-1/2 in. (38 mm) overlap between the slip

section and the pipe section.

• Secure the pipe and slip section with two screws no

longer than 1/2 in. (13 mm), using the pilot holes in the
slip section. See Figure 10.7.

C. Secure the Vent Sections

• Vertical runs originating off the top of the appliance, with

no offsets, must be supported every 8 ft. (2.44 m) after
the maximum allowed 25 ft. (7.62 m) of unsupported rise.

• Vertical runs originating off the rear of the appliance, or

after any elbow, must be supported every 8 ft. (2.44 m).

• Horizontal runs must be supported every 5 feet (1.52

m).

• Vent supports or plumbers strap (spaced 120º apart)

may be used to support vent sections. See Figures 10.8
and 10.9.

• Wall shield fi restops may be used to provide horizontal

support to vent sections.

• SLP ceiling fi restops have tabs that may be used to

provide vertical support.

WARNING! Risk of Fire, Explosion or Asphyxiation!
Improper support may allow vent to sag and separate.
Use vent run supports and connect vent sections per in-
stallation instructions. DO NOT allow vent to sag below
connection point to appliance.
